Vote contract (#1552)
* Add Vote Contract * Move ownership of LeaderScheduler from Fullnode to the bank * Modified ReplicateStage to consume leader information from bank * Restart RPC Services in Leader To Validator Transition * Make VoteContract Context Free * Remove voting from ClusterInfo and Tpu * Remove dependency on ActiveValidators in LeaderScheduler * Switch VoteContract to have two steps 1) Register 2) Vote. Change thin client to create + register a voting account on fullnode startup * Remove check in leader_to_validator transition for unique references to bank, b/c jsonrpc service and rpcpubsub hold references through jsonhttpserver
